Capacity note for the Bramblewick export retry queue. Failed exports are requeued with exponential backoff, and the queue depth is our main capacity signal: sustained depth above the high-water mark means downstream Pellis storage is saturated, not that we need more workers. As the new contractor, please don't raise worker counts without checking storage latency first — it usually makes things worse. Retry timing, backoff caps, and the high-water threshold are all driven by the constants shown below.

limits module of yagef-bajog:
TIERS = {
    "druael": 370,
    "tamix": 286,
    "pelius": 541,
    "pelael": 78,
    "pelox": 47,
    "ralath": 533,
    "drumir": 801,
}

Welcome to the on-call rotation for Slatebound, our school timetable solver. Most pages relate to solver runs exceeding the memory ceiling during term-boundary recalculation. Input data is scrubbed of student identifiers before it reaches the solver tier, which matters for your review scope. Access is gated by the standard staff role. The escalation matrix and data-handling notes are on the internal solver page.

operations page: https://confluence.nelvroworks.example/dash/spaces/board/job/pipeline/issue/spaces/b9c0f0fbc164027c4eb481af

CI heads-up on the ChipGate reader firmware tests. The emulator for the timing-chip reader started failing auth handshakes after we bumped the crypto lib — looks like the test fixture still uses the old nonce length, not an actual vuln, but worth your eyes. Nothing sensitive leaks in logs as far as I can tell. Repro run is tagged below.

trace token, fafog-kageg: htk4_98e6

Subject: Deep-link routing ownership change

Team — routing for the Ferngate mobile app is changing hands. All deep-link path registrations, the universal-link manifest, and the fallback web redirects now live under the Navigations squad. New members: do not edit route tables directly; open a request in the Ferngate board instead. Legacy Skylark-era routes are frozen until Q3. Questions about migration timing go to the squad lead. Effective Monday, the new owner of deep-link routing is the person named below.

named custodian: Belius Casath Ulaix Sorius